Getting to know Stacee Williams

Hello family. My name is Stacee Williams, LCSW. I am an African American female therapist with 20 years of experience in the mental health field. I began my career in 2000 working in community mental health in Los Angeles. In 2007, I became a therapist, and in 2016, I was licensed as an LCSW in California. I earned my Master’s in Social Work from California State University, Long Beach. I treat depression, anxiety, grief and loss, family issues, trauma, workplace discrimination, and symptoms of PTSD. My professional experience has focused on supporting Black women, women in general, and people of color. Healing is a long-term process, and it is very important to me both as a therapist and as a woman.

More information on payments and coverage

Payment is due after each session and will be charged with your card on file for any portion of patient responsibility. Receipts will be provided at the time of the charge. This typically takes place 2-4 weeks after the session, once your insurance has had a chance to process the claim. We try our best to verify eligibility, but it is ultimately your responsibility to check coverage and out-of-pocket costs for services. For out-of-network visits, you will be billed at the provider’s self-pay rate, and we can provide an invoice for you to submit to your insurance for potential out-of-network reimbursement based on your plan’s benefits.
